Those days are long gone when people with decent jobs were offered medical or dental insurances as part of their employment package. This is not the case anymore; small businesses just cannot afford it. So when it comes down to your dental health, what should you decide: dental insurance or dental discount plan?
Dental insurance policies, nowadays, are too expensive for an average American to buy. They do not have the financial means to meet the requirements of the policies due to their very high premiums. Moreover, dental insurance does not cover any of your free existing condition. Like for instance, the automobile insurance, the insurers take a good look of your vehicle and mark any of the fault it may have so they cannot be tricked into covering for it. Similarly, dental cover plan only includes any issue that might result after the insurance has been bought. Moreover, the waiting period to get covered and your issue to be taken care of can take as long as six months to up to a year. In addition, dental plans are more maintenance oriented; the dentists may take care of your tooth cleaning and give you a fluoride treatment in order to save future complications which may cost even more money. This is also known as preventive maintenance.
However, discount dental plans portray a completely different side of the story. Discount dental plans provide you with discount, from up to 10 percent to 60 percent. All the doctors that are part of this plan are qualified to practice. Even your doctor might be part of one of the networks and you’re not even aware of it. The most interesting part is that you do not have to file any paper work, but you have to pay the doctor in cash. Discount dental plans cover any pre existing condition that you might have, whether it is a simple procedure such as cleaning or a complicated procedure such as dental implant. Also there is no waiting period; it’s almost like the ‘pay as you go’ service. Furthermore, dental plans are extremely affordable. They could be as low as $80 to $90 annually for an individual, or $150 to $160 for an entire family.
